ho (Greek #3588)
the definite article; the (sometimes to be supplied, at others omitted, in English idiom)
KJV usage: the, this, that, one, he, she, it, etc.
Pronounce: ho
Origin: ἡ (hay), and the neuter τό (to) in all their inflections
kategoros (Greek #2725)
against one in the assembly, i.e. a complainant at law; specially, Satan
KJV usage: accuser.
Pronounce: kat-ay'-gor-os
Origin: from 2596 and 58
